HD Ratings: 3D To Be Deep-Sixed

Within days of announcing it wasn’t renewing MasterChef NZ, TV3 has revealed it’s planning to axe HD current affairs half-hour 3D. The announcement follows another week of lousy ratings, with Monday’s 9.30 broadcast averaging only 1.2% – 3.0% of the core commercial demographics. 3D has struggled from the outset. HD Ratings: Round One of Format Wars

NZ versions of top-rating Aussie formats faced off for the first time on Monday, with mixed results. TV2’s season premiere of My Kitchen Rules NZ averaged 7.5% – 14.8% in the commercial demographics off the back of Shortland Street’s 11.1% – 21.5%. HD Heads-Up: May 23-29

Thunderbirds are going to a new berth and TV2 looks as it’s jettisoning its Sunday comedies. After weeks of low ratings, Thunderbirds Are Go is shifting back an hour, from 7.00 Sunday to 6.00, as of May 24. Sony’s New 3D Helmet for the Home

Sony has just announced its head-mounted “personal 3D viewer” will go on sale here this month for $1200. A world first, the HMZ-T1 promises to deliver a “movie theatre-like virtual screen experience” that Sony says is ideal for 3D movies and gaming. Samsung’s Sizzling New Plasma TVs Start to Ship

Samsung has started to ship its new, 3D-capable “Plasma+1” TVs. The D8000, D6900, D550 and D490/450 series have a narrow bezel that adds an extra inch of viewable screen size over Samsung’s 2010 plasma TVs.
